Key Warning Information in Safety Data Sheet (SDS) of n-Butyl Acrylate
in the chemical industry, n-butyl acrylate (Butyl Acrylate) is a common chemical, widely used in the production of coatings, adhesives, plastics and other composite materials. As a potentially dangerous chemical, the safety management and protective measures of n-butyl acrylate are very important. This article will combine the key information in the safety data sheet (SDS) of n-butyl acrylate to analyze its potential risks and countermeasures.
1. Physical and chemical properties and potential hazards
n-Butyl acrylate is a colorless, flammable liquid with a slight ether odor. According to SDS, its physicochemical properties include a low flash point (about -7°C), flammable vapors, and sensitivity to light and air. These properties make it a high risk of fire and explosion during storage and transportation. Therefore, it is clearly pointed out in SDS that n-butyl acrylate should be kept away from fire and heat sources and stored in a cool and well-ventilated place.
2. Health hazards and protective measures
The effect of n-butyl acrylate on health is mainly reflected in its volatility. Long-term exposure to high concentrations of n-butyl acrylate vapor may cause acute poisoning symptoms such as headache, dizziness, and nausea. It can also cause irritation to the skin and eyes and even trigger allergic reactions. The SDS emphasizes that operators should wear protective glasses, gloves and respiratory protection to reduce the possibility of direct contact and inhalation.
3. Environmental impact and waste disposal
Butyl acrylate is toxic to the environment and may cause harm to aquatic organisms. It is also highly biodegradable, which means that its impact is limited in the natural environment. The SDS recommends that when disposing of waste, it should be dumped into a special hazardous waste collection container and disposal in accordance with local regulations. Avoid direct discharge of n-butyl acrylate into water or soil.
4. Fire and explosion risk
Due to the flammability of n-butyl acrylate, the risk of fire and explosion is particularly emphasized in the SDS. During storage and transportation, it must be kept away from fire sources, heat sources and oxidants. In the event of a fire, use dry powder fire extinguishers, carbon dioxide fire extinguishers or fire extinguishing equipment suitable for extinguishing Class B fires. It is worth noting that the vapor of n-butyl acrylate may form an explosive mixture in the air, so when used in a confined space, good ventilation must be ensured.
5. First Aid Measures and Accident Handling
In the SDS, first aid measures for n-butyl acrylate are detailed. In case of skin contact, rinse immediately with soap and water for at least 15 minutes; in case of eye contact, rinse immediately with running water for at least 15 minutes and seek medical help; in case of inhalation, immediately remove the patient to fresh air and, if necessary, perform artificial respiration or oxygen therapy. In case of leakage, personnel shall be evacuated quickly and treated with explosion-proof equipment.
6. Safe storage and operation advice
The SDS also provides specific recommendations on the storage and handling of n-butyl acrylate. It should be stored in a cool, well-ventilated place away from fire sources and away from direct sunlight. During operation, ensure that the equipment is sealed to reduce steam leakage. Regularly check the integrity of the storage container to ensure that there is no leakage or damage.
